src:iceweasel has been superseded by src:firefox-esr in version 45.0esr-1 in March 2016. Transitional packages to ease upgrades were provided in the wheezy, jessie, stretch and buster releases. The transitional packages have been removed finally before the bullseye release in August 2021. After regular security support for buster ended in August 2022 and LTS support ended in June 2024, I'm closing the remaining bug reports now. Andreas
